Water
Proper watering is essential for the health and vitality of the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 plant. While it is relatively drought-tolerant once established, consistent moisture is vital, particularly during periods of heat and dryness. It’s important to strike a balance, as overly soggy conditions can lead to root rot, while prolonged dry spells can stress the plant.
Hibiscus Berry Awesome watering:
– Water deeply, allowing the soil to dry slightly between waterings
– During periods of prolonged drought, provide supplemental watering
– Avoid waterlogging the soil to prevent root rot
Sunlight
The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 thrives in full sun to partial shade, making it a versatile choice for various garden settings. Adequate sunlight is crucial for robust growth and abundant flowering, and the plant typically performs best when provided with ample sunlight.
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 sunlight requirements:
– Plant in a location that receives at least 6-8 hours of direct sunlight per day
– In warmer regions, some afternoon shade can help protect the plant from excessive heat
– Ensure the plant has access to sufficient sunlight to promote flowering and overall vigor
Fertilizer
Proper fertilization can significantly impact the growth and blooming capacity of the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’. Regular feeding with a balanced fertilizer can help support healthy foliage, robust blooms, and overall plant resilience.
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 fertilizer:
– Use a well-balanced, slow-release fertilizer formulated for flowering plants
– Apply fertilizer in spring as new growth emerges, and then again in mid-summer to sustain flowering
– Foll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for application rates and frequency
Soil
The right soil conditions are crucial for the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 to thrive. Well-draining, fertile soil with a slightly acidic to neutral pH is ideal for this plant, allowing for adequate root aeration and nutrient uptake.
Hibiscus Berry Awesome soil requirements:
– Plant in loamy, well-draining soil with good moisture retention
– If the soil is heavy or compacted, consider amending it with organic matter to improve drainage
– Aim for a pH range of 6.0-6.8 for optimal nutrient availability
Pruning
Proper pruning not only helps maintain the aesthetic appeal of the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 but also promotes healthy growth and encourages abundant flowering. Pruning also enables the removal of dead or diseased wood, improving the overall vigor of the plant.
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 pruning:
– Conduct regular pruning in late winter or early spring to remove any damaged or weak growth
– Deadhead spent flowers to encourage continuous blooming and prevent seed formation
– Trim back the plant lightly after the flowering season to promote branching and compact growth
Propagation
The propagation of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 can be achieved through various methods, providing gardeners with the opportunity to expand their plant collection or share this beautiful variety with others.
Seed Propagation
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 seeds can be collected from mature seed pods and sown to produce new plants. While growing from seeds can be a rewarding process, it’s important to note that seed-grown plants may display natural variations from the parent plant.
Hibiscus Berry Awesome propagation from seeds:
– Collect mature seed pods and extract the seeds for sowing
– Sow the seeds in a well-draining seed-starting medium and keep them consistently moist
– Once the seedlings have developed several true leaves, they can be transplanted into individual containers or the garden
Cutting Propagation
Propagating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 from cuttings is an effective way to create genetically identical plants, ensuring that the new specimens retain the desired characteristics of the parent plant.
Hibiscus Berry Awesome propagation from cuttings:
– Take 4-6 inch cuttings from healthy, non-flowering shoots in the spring or early summer
– Remove the lower leaves and dip the cut end in a rooting hormone to encourage root development
– Plant the cuttings in a well-draining rooting medium and keep them consistently moist while they develop roots

Common Diseases
While the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 is relatively resilient, it is susceptible to certain diseases that can impact its health and vitality. Understanding these common diseases and their symptoms is essential for timely intervention and effective management.
Disease Diagnosis
1. Leaf Spot (Cercospora and Anthracnose)
- Symptoms: Irregularly shaped brown spots on the leaves, which may expand and cause leaf yellowing and defoliation
- Management: Remove and destroy affected foliage, improve air circulation, and consider fungicidal treatments if the issue persists
2. Powdery Mildew
- Symptoms: A white powdery coating on the leaves and stems, typically accompanied by stunted growth and leaf distortion
- Management: Provide adequate air circulation, avoid overhead watering, and apply fungicidal treatments if necessary
3. Root Rot
- Symptoms: Wilting, yellowing, and eventual collapse of the plant, often accompanied by a foul odor and dark, mushy roots
- Management: Ensure well-draining soil, moderate watering, and proper plant spacing to reduce excess moisture around the roots
Common Pests
In addition to diseases, the Hibiscus ‘Berry Awesome’ may encounter pest infestations that can impact its overall health and appearance. Identifying and addressing these common pests is essential for preserving the plant’s vitality.
Pest Identification
1. Aphids
- Identification: Small, soft-bodied insects clustered on the undersides of leaves, typically green, black, or brown in color
- Management: Use a strong stream of water to dislodge aphids, introduce beneficial insects, or apply insecticidal soap as a targeted treatment
2. Whiteflies
- Identification: Tiny, white, moth-like insects that can be found on the undersides of leaves, often causing leaf yellowing and wilting
- Management: Introduce natural predators, such as ladybugs, or use insecticidal soap to control whitefly populations
3. Scale Insects
- Identification: Small, waxy bumps on the stems or leaves, which can lead to weakened growth and yellowing of the foliage
- Management: Remove scale insects manually, and consider applying horticultural oil to suffocate and control the infestation
